Mastering the Art of Managing your Time: A Path to Productivity and Success

Managing your time is a finite resource, and how effectively you manage it can significantly impact your personal and professional life. Whether you’re a student, a professional, an entrepreneur, or someone looking to enhance your daily routine, mastering the art of time management is the key to boosting productivity and achieving your goals. In this article, we’ll explore the concept of time management, its importance, and provide practical steps to help you take control of your time and become more efficient.

Understanding Managing your Time

Time management is the process of planning, organizing, and controlling the use of your time to accomplish specific tasks and goals. It’s about making deliberate choices and decisions regarding what you do, when you do it, and how you allocate your time.

The Importance of Managing your Time

Effective time management is vital for several reasons:

1. Productivity: It allows you to accomplish more tasks in less time, increasing your overall productivity.

2. Stress Reduction: Properly managed time can reduce stress and anxiety associated with missed deadlines and rushed work.

3. Goal Achievement: Time management helps you allocate time to work on your goals, ensuring that you make progress toward them consistently.

4. Work-Life Balance: By efficiently managing your time, you can create a healthier balance between your personal and professional life.

5. Improved Decision-Making: Time management enables you to prioritize tasks and make informed decisions about where to invest your time and energy.

Steps to Improve Time Management

Now, let’s explore practical steps to help you enhance your time management skills:

 1. Set Clear Goals

Start by defining your goals, both short-term and long-term. Clear goals give you a purpose and direction for your time management efforts.

 2. Prioritize Tasks

Use methods like the Eisenhower Matrix to categorize tasks by urgency and importance. Focus on high-priority tasks and delegate or eliminate low-priority ones.

 3. Create a Schedule

Develop a daily, weekly, or monthly schedule that allocates specific blocks of time for various tasks. Include buffer time for unexpected interruptions.

 4. Use Time Management Tools

Leverage time management tools and techniques, such as to-do lists, time blocking, and task management apps to help you stay organized.

 5. Learn to Say No

Avoid overcommitting yourself by saying no to tasks and obligations that do not align with your goals or priorities.

 6. Eliminate Distractions

Identify common distractions in your work environment, and take steps to reduce or eliminate them. This may include silencing notifications, closing unnecessary tabs, and creating a dedicated workspace.

 7. Break Tasks into Smaller Steps

Divide large projects or goals into smaller, manageable tasks. Breaking tasks down into smaller steps can make them less overwhelming and easier to tackle.

 8. Set Realistic Expectations

Don’t set unrealistic expectations for your day. Recognize your limitations and allow for flexibility in your schedule.

 9. Delegate and Outsource

Delegate tasks when possible, whether it’s at work or in your personal life. Outsourcing can free up time for more important responsibilities.

 10. Learn to Focus

Improve your focus by practicing techniques such as the Pomodoro Technique, which involves working in focused, concentrated bursts with short breaks.

 11. Practice Mindfulness

Mindfulness and meditation can help you stay present and reduce anxiety associated with time management. It can improve your decision-making and concentration.

 12. Regularly Review Your Goals

Frequently review your goals and priorities. This will help ensure that you remain aligned with your objectives and make necessary adjustments when needed.

 13. Stay Organized

Keep your workspace, both digital and physical, organized. Use tools such as calendars, planners, and digital note-taking apps to stay on top of tasks and deadlines.

 14. Learn from Your Mistakes

Mistakes and setbacks are a part of time management. Use them as learning opportunities and make adjustments to your approach.

 15. Take Breaks and Rest

Rest and relaxation are essential for maintaining productivity. Schedule breaks and time for self-care to recharge your energy and focus.

 16. Be Accountable

Share your goals and progress with someone who can help hold you accountable. An accountability partner can provide encouragement and motivation.

Conclusion

Mastering the art of time management is a journey that can significantly enhance your productivity and overall quality of life. Whether you’re a student striving to excel academically, a professional aiming to advance your career, or an entrepreneur seeking to grow your business, effective time management is a valuable skill.

Remember that time management is not about doing more in less time, but about making conscious choices and allocating your time to what truly matters. Start with small, manageable changes, and gradually refine your approach to achieve optimal time management. As you practice and refine your time management skills, you’ll find that you can accomplish more with less stress and enjoy greater success in your personal and professional life.
